Remi & Sensible J

Rapper Remi returns with his first new release since last year’s ‘Black Hole Sun’ EP, new single ‘5am’. Collaborating once again with production partner Sensible J, the track sees him exorcising relationship and mental health issues, seemingly without filter. Singer Whosane then drops in a chorus to top off the effortless-sounding song.

“I wrote ‘5am’ when I was locked in the house for a couple of days with the flu”, explains Remi. “I guess I was trying to get all the shit out of my body or something, because my mind wandered to a toxic past relationship and I just needed to write about it”.

“I hadn’t dealt with many parts of it, so there was a lot of real-time processing and redrafting before I could properly articulate the whole situation”, he goes on. “Sensible J, with the help of Silent J, had already created the perfect beat-scape for me to vent over”.

Remi will be touring the UK with a handful of dates next month, supporting Black Milk in Manchester, Bristol and Leeds before a headline show at London’s Jazz Café on 15 Aug.
